masovn

Norwegian Bokmål

Etymology

Uncertain, possibly from German Mass or Masse, or even from the god Mars, [Term?] + ovn.

Noun

masovn m (definite singular masovnen, indefinite plural masovner, definite plural masovnene)

  1. a blast furnace
